Replacing Alarm Sensors, etc.....

    I've just had new windows fitted and all the alarm thingies are hanging by the wires. I want to replace these rather than refit the old ones. I've been advised that once they are removed they should be replaced (no idea if that's actually true).

    So as I'm no alarm expert, I'll ask a few questions.

    1. Can I reuse the old ones or should I just replace them?

    2. Where can I buy these item and how much are they?

    3. Is it just a matter of swapping over the sensors (anti tamper and perimeter)?

    The alarm is an Airtech model and is probably 10 years old. It worked perfectly until the sensors were removed (open zones all over the place) so I'd imagine it'll work fine with new sensors. I've a few PIRs which won't need replacing.

    Had my own windows changed recently and was in the same dilema.
    A close relation of mine has his own Alarm company and he changed all sensors and had to reset the sensativity of shock sensor to suit the new windows.

    I know you had someone you know do it, but how much did it set you back? How many windows?


  • Registered Users, Registered Users 2 Posts: 213 ✭✭mildews


    Can't remember exactly how much. The figure of €130 comes to mind. this was for nine windows, all with shock sensor and two breakers per window and also for Three external doors (front door, back door and patio door)
